On Saturday 24 February 2024, Eco Foundation and Mahalakshmi Vikas Seva Samiti organized a seminar in Mumbai to provide information about going to Canada for further studies after 12th and graduation.

In which information was given to the students and parents by Firoz Khan Sahab, originally from India and now settled in Canada.

Firoz Khan Sahab is a retired officer of Indian Railways and his wife is a retired officer of a bank.

Firoz Khan Sahab has worked as a security officer in Canada.

He is proficient in 5 languages and has worked as a translator officer in the Canadian Embassy.

He also runs a social organization. And attempts to help Indian students live, eat and get admission in college in Canada.

Firoz Khan Saheb said,

To go to Canada, first of all you will have to give IELTS General Training Test, and to take the exam you will have to pay Rs 15000.

An official fee of Rs 15000 will have to be paid.

Therefore, students were asked to pass the examination once so that the financial burden on their parents does not increase.

Diploma and certificate courses are offered after 12th in Canada.

Visit Canada's official site www.canada.ca and learn more about Canada.

If students move to Canada after graduation, they are likely to get citizenship soon.

After 2 years of study, there is a possibility of getting citizen ship after 3 years,

It takes 5 years to settle there.

Before going to any agent, get their information so that you do not get admission in any taluk level college in Canada and ensure that you get admission in the top college in Canada.

It was specifically said not to make any fake documents to go to Canada.

To travel to Canada, the student must complete the process of opening his/her bank account within 48 hours of reaching Canada.

Only students can withdraw the money deposited in the bank.

Students are allowed to work 30 hours a week.

In Canada, it gets cold from -25 to -30 degrees, but do not worry, there is clothing according to the weather, from November to February people work less and stay at home. It is important to save money.

Shri Lalitbhai Lunavara gave detailed information about how students get loans.

Because to take a loan, you must have your own property so that you can mortgage it.

Whatever period you take the loan for, so that if the student falls ill or faces any other problem, the loan can be repaid later.

  A one-time travel fare is added to the loan to pay college fees, books, laptop, hostel rent, etc.
